AbstractThe rise of modern architecture styles has strongly impacted the younger generation globally in the current century. This research is designed to study the performance of working memory on understanding Lanna architecture with young adults at a large university in northern Thailand, that of Mae Fah Luang University in Chiang Rai Province, Thailand. In this study, the research focuses on studying the effectiveness of young adults' working memory to discern Lanna architecture through site visits and mental visualization. The outcomes of this research can help improve architecture pedagogy in the future. For the methodology, questionnaires were used by collecting data from 412 university students from a university in northern Thailand. The data then were analyzed using mean, standard deviation, and p-value. This study concludes that the performance of working memory on the comprehension of Lanna architecture through site visits and mental visualization for young adults was positive. (As Provided).
